UKFSF Fantasy identity profiler

This short assessment looks at how you engage with sport and fantasy: from the way you follow, research and discuss sport to how you compete, participate and use digital content.

It measures eight behavioural dimensions and compares your pattern with five reference fantasy identities developed in our launch report Defining the UK Fantasy Sports Audience. Your answers will be used to build a personalised profile showing where you sit across each dimension, which fantasy identity you most closely resemble, and how your overall pattern compares with other types of fantasy sports player.

    About your result

    Your fantasy identity is based on how you answered questions across eight dimensions: immersion, information, community, participation, competition, convenience, social connection and routine.

    Your answers are compared with five fantasy identity profiles developed by the UKFSF in the research for its flagship launch report, Defining the UK Fantasy Sports Audience. Your strongest identity is the profile that most closely matches your overall pattern of answers, while your secondary identity and individual traits show the nuances within that result.

    The profiler is designed as a way to explore how you engage with sport and fantasy, rather than to put you into a fixed category. Your result reflects the particular combination of motivations, behaviours and preferences shown in your answers.
